yeah, keepin it here was a good idea, but make sure one of your parents or one of your friends stops by every other or every third day and starts you car and lets it idle till warm and then revs it a bit. plus make sure, since no one is driving it, that the gas is flushed a couple of times during the year. ^^^^hmm, best covering for a car outdoors??? a GARAGE . i really have no idea but make sure its water proof yet breatable, the last thing you want is hot moisture trapped next to your baby, my grandfather had to repaint his old BMW 2002 because the car cover he had didnt breath and caused the paint to bubble(and things of that nature).
